The Ethereum Foundation is hiring a protocol security researcher to combine AI tools, fuzz testing, and manual audits, following experiments in which coordinated AI agents identified real vulnerabilities, including a remotely triggered panic in the libp2p gossipsub component fixed before public disclosure as CVE-2026-34219.
The Ethereum Foundation is expanding its efforts to protect Ethereum’s core infrastructure by hiring a protocol security researcher focused on identifying vulnerabilities through artificial intelligence, fuzz testing, and manual code audits.
The new researcher will join the Foundation’s Protocol Security team and examine potential weaknesses across key components of the Ethereum network, including the execution layer, consensus layer, peer-to-peer infrastructure, client software, and protocol specifications.
According to the Foundation’s job posting, the role will involve developing fuzzing tools, reviewing protocol changes ahead of hard forks, auditing updates manually, and coordinating the disclosure of confirmed security issues.
The position also highlights the growing use of AI in Ethereum security research. AI systems can scan large amounts of code and generate potential vulnerabilities at a scale that would be difficult to achieve through manual testing alone.
However, the Foundation’s recent experiments show that automated detection is only part of the process. Human researchers remain essential for reproducing suspected flaws, determining their actual impact, and distinguishing genuine vulnerabilities from false positives.
The hiring follows recent experiments by the Ethereum Foundation’s Protocol Security team involving coordinated AI agents tasked with examining protocol code, cryptographic software, and other components used across the network.
In a July 9 technical post, the team reported that the agents identified genuine security flaws, including a remotely triggered panic affecting the libp2p gossipsub component used by Ethereum’s consensus clients. The vulnerability was fixed before being publicly disclosed as CVE-2026-34219.
The experiments also demonstrated an important limitation of AI-driven security testing: identifying potential bugs is easier than confirming that they represent real security threats. Researchers needed reproducible evidence, proof-of-concept demonstrations, and human verification before validating the findings.
This approach effectively combines AI-powered vulnerability discovery with human-led security assessment, creating multiple layers of protection for Ethereum’s infrastructure.
Ethereum’s security requirements extend beyond protecting the blockchain itself. The network increasingly serves as infrastructure for stablecoins, tokenized assets, decentralized applications, and institutional financial products.
A vulnerability in an Ethereum client, consensus mechanism, or peer-to-peer layer could therefore have consequences across a much broader ecosystem.
The Foundation’s decision to invest in specialized security research suggests that protocol resilience remains a priority as Ethereum continues to evolve through upgrades and increasingly complex applications.
Ethereum’s security strategy appears to be shifting from reactive vulnerability management toward continuous, technology-assisted testing. The combination of AI, fuzzing, and human audits could help the network identify weaknesses earlier without relying exclusively on traditional code reviews. As more financial activity moves onto Ethereum, strengthening its underlying infrastructure becomes just as important as improving scalability or functionality.
